Economics, is the social science that studies the production, distribution, and consumption of resources. By extension, economics also studies economies, the creation and distribution of wealth, the abundance and scarcity of resources, and human welfare.

An economy is the system of human activities related to the production, distribution, exchange, and consumption of goods and services of a country or other area.
